In some environments that support the requestAnimationFrame timestamp callback parameter using it results in smoother animations. Note: the rAF timestamp is using the same API as performance.now() under the hood so they're compatible with each other. However, some browsers support rAF (with a timestamp parameter) but not performance.now() so using them both would introduce an error. This commit stops using rAF in browsers that don't support performance.now(). From all the browsers jQuery supports this only affects iOS <9 (currently less than 5% of all iOS users) which will now not use rAF. Fixes jquerygh-3143 Closes jquerygh-3151
